Index/Block - 000000000129304dcd073c8fcf4cf6741c3a5ca88558d36f9b2cad2cee54fe09

Intro

430776

000000000129304dcd073c8fcf4cf6741c3a5ca88558d36f9b2cad2cee54fe09

123573dc82f7a00684d9a579a81f058f14e9814f7e5018521a757089c4266487

0000000000efa461cb1b709e21b65fdfd1054709e2be78d962ac948f2daeaa9f

3636031044

587572628

1679597006 (2023-03-23 18:43:26)

WuhanBioTech

ㄜ5:248

18Yt6UbnDKaXaBaMPnBdEHomRYVKwcGgyH

0

⇆ Tx List

- none -